简介
calnet 是一款前端开发中常用的轻量级计算网络工具包。使用 calnet 可以简化前端开发过程中的数据计算和网络请求操作,使得开发者能够更加专注于业务逻辑的开发。
安装
在安装 calnet 之前需要确认已经安装了 Node.js 环境和 npm 包管理器。使用以下命令在项目中安装 calnet 包:
npm install calnet
核心功能
数据处理和计算
calnet 提供了各种处理和计算数据的方法,包括但不限于:
数组求和
const calnet = require('calnet'); const numbers = [1, 2, 3, 4, 5]; const result = calnet.sum(numbers); // result 的值为 15
数组平均值
const calnet = require('calnet'); const numbers = [1, 2, 3, 4, 5]; const result = calnet.average(numbers); // result 的值为 3
数组中位数
const calnet = require('calnet'); const numbers = [1, 2, 3, 4, 5]; const result = calnet.median(numbers); // result 的值为 3
数组过滤
const calnet = require('calnet'); const numbers = [1, 2, 3, 4, 5]; const result = calnet.filter(numbers, (num) => num % 2 === 0); // result 的值为 [2, 4]
数组排序
const calnet = require('calnet'); const numbers = [3, 1, 4, 2, 5]; const result = calnet.sort(numbers); // result 的值为 [1, 2, 3, 4, 5]
网络请求
calnet 提供了通过 Promise 封装的网络请求方法,支持 GET、POST、PUT 和 DELETE 方法。使用以下命令发送 GET 请求:
const calnet = require('calnet'); calnet.get('http://localhost:3000/api/data') .then((response) => { console.log(response.data); }) .catch((error) => { console.error(error) });
使用以下命令发送 POST 请求:
-- -------------------- ---- ------- ----- ------ - ------------------ ----- ---- - - ----- ------- ---- -- -- --------------------------------------------- ----- ---------------- -- - --------------------------- -- -------------- -- - -------------------- ---
示例代码
以下示例代码展示如何使用 calnet 进行数据处理和网络请求操作:
-- -------------------- ---- ------- ----- ------ - ------------------ ----- ------- - --- -- -- -- --- ----- --- - -------------------- ------------------- ----- ----- ------- - ------------------------ ----------------------- --------- ----- ------ - ----------------------- ---------------------- -------- ----- ----------- - ---------------------- ----- -- --- - - --- --- --------------------------- ------------- ----- ------------- - --------------------- ----------------------------- --------------- -------------------------------------------- ---------------- -- - ---------------- ----------- --------------- -- -------------- -- - ------------------ -------- ------- --- ----- ---- - - ----- ------- ---- -- -- --------------------------------------------- ----- ---------------- -- - ----------------- ----------- --------------- -- -------------- -- - ------------------- -------- ------- ---
总结
在本文中,我们介绍了 npm 包 calnet 的使用教程,包含了数据处理和网络请求等核心功能的使用方法,并提供了示例代码进行演示。使用 calnet 可以将前端开发中的数据处理和网络请求操作变得更加简单和高效。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066c92ccdc64669dde5a68